132kV CONVENTIONAL SWITCHGEAR

Outdoor 132kV double busbar 3150A open terminal switchgear with fault ra ng,
as stated in the Contract, of 31.5kA for 3 seconds.

Minimum Specific Creepage Distance for outdoor equipment shall be 25 mm/kV.

ALL EQUIPMENT SHALL BE 3-PHASE UNLESS STATED OTHERWISE.

The equipment to be supplied and installed are generally as shown on drawings


(refer to tender drawings) and as detailed in the Specifica ons complete with
galvanized steel support structures, access ladders, pla orm, and walkways,
where relevant and necessary etc., to complete, comprising: -

LR LIGHTNING PROTECTION SYSTEM USING LIGHTNING RODS:

The lightning protec on system shall include various components including


lightning rods and eleva on rods, PVC insulated copper (for counters) and copper
tape down conductor, control junc on, earth termina on system and lightning
strike counter wherever appropriate for complete shielding of switchyard and
plant against direct lightning strikes.

The lightning protec on system study report shall be submi ed for approval.

Quan ty Item
a Lump sump Lightning rods
b Lump sump Lightning counter
c Lump sump Accessories and fi ngs

Complete descrip ons of the lightning rods system are as per TNB specifica on.

ES SUBSTATION EARTHING SYSTEM

Earthing system for the substa on and all equipment comprising complete set of
copper tapes, earth electrodes, test links, etc., and all connec ons to equipment
for all voltage levels supplied under this Contract including, where relevant but
not limited to steel-reinforce bonded to the perimeter fencing, interface
requirements with exis ng earthing system and earthing or lightning protec on
system of buildings, underground cables, and overhead lines. The soil resis vity,
earthing study report and calcula on shall be submi ed for approval.

Where reasonably prac cal, earthing conductors shall be embedded in concrete


for purpose of control against the .

Complete descrip ons of the earthing system are as per TNB specifica on.

132-OHF/DRP 132kV INDOOR DIGITAL PROTECTION RELAY PANEL FOR OVERHEAD


LINE FEEDER BAY EQUIPPED WITH: -

a) Current Differen al with IEC61850 protec on relays suitable for three


terminal uses (to be matched with remote end) with op cal fibre links,
interfacing with PCM Mul plexer via IEEE C37.94 protocol.
b) Backup Distance with IEC61850 protec on relay
c) Breaker Management with IEC61850 (CBM)
d) Trip circuit supervision for each trip coils
e) Electrically reset lockout master tripping relay.
f) Front mounted AC 240V 13A supply socket
g) Group isola on link for each main, backup protec on and CBM
h) Glazed transparent acrylic window front cover door.
i) All necessary selector switch, auxiliary relays, bistable relays,
contactors, MCB's, test terminal blocks, sliding link terminals blocks,
drawing compartment, fibre op c connectors, indica ng lamps,
energy saving LED, earthing bar, trip links, etc., to complete.

Note: The characteris c of propose Current Transformer as follows: -

Core 1: 900/450/1A Class 5P20, 30VA for Main Protec on


Core 2: 900/450/1A Class 5P20, 30VA for Backup Protec on
Core 3: 900/450/1A Class 0.5, 30VA, FS5 for Bay Controller and Instrumenta on

Page 9 of 34
Core 4: 3000/1A Class PX, Vk≥600V, Rct ≤12 Ohm and Im≤10mA at Vk/2 for
busbar protec on – Spare
Core 5: 3000/1A Class PX, Vk≥600V, Rct ≤12 Ohm and Im≤10mA at Vk/2 for
busbar protec on – Low Impedance

Note: The characteris cs of proposed Voltage Transformer as follows: -


Secondary Winding 1: Class 3P, 50VA for Protec on
Secondary Winding 2: Class 0.5, 50VA for Instrument and Control

The CT and VT calcula on shall be submi ed for approval.

APC AUXILIARY POWER AND CONTROL CABLES

Interfacing cables between all equipment supplied under this Contract.


and supplied by others.

The Works to be inclusive of: -


a) Mul core, screened twisted pair and screened copper Ethernet (minimum
CAT 5E) cables for all primary and secondary equipment including the
telecontrol equipment, telecommunica on equipment, Ethernet Managed
Switch (ESM) etc. to complete.
b) The complete set of auxiliary power, mul core control cables including cable
trays, cable ladders, racks, cleats, supports, cable glands and all necessary
termina ons kits, etc. to complete.
c) All relevant schemes not limited to the following, e.g., voltage selec on,
synchronizing, busbar protec on, live transfer, interlocking, monitoring,
measurement, inter-tripping i.e., sending/receiving to remote end
substa ons etc., to complete.

All cables shall be direct buried (at switchyard subject to soil inves ga on result)
and/or laid on cable ladder/trays (inside control building. The cable ladder/trays
to match with exis ng size where applicable) as per TNB specifica on. Op cal
fiber cables outside of building shall be laid in HDPE pipe, while inside of building
shall be laid in flexible metal corrugated conduits.

For cable laying inside cable trench with the depth is equals or more than
600mm, cable trays shall be provided inclusive of supports for cable trays fixed in
concrete. Where cable tray is provided, minimum width of cable trench shall be
1000mm.

OFC FIBRE OPTIC CABLES: -

Interfacing fiber op c cables including op cal fibre connectors, op cal fibre


junc on boxes, cable management guide, cable trays/casing, cable spare and all
necessary termina ons between all equipment supplied under this contract and
supplied by others including the following to complete: -

a) Backbone communica on for IEC 61850 Sta on Bus between Managed


Ethernet Switches.
b) Cabling between Managed Ethernet Switches and IEDs or Clients
c) Cabling from Line Protec on IEDs to Communica on Panel
d) Cable Management and Accessories.

Any cabling between buildings or panels with physical distance apart shall be laid
in the form of armoured cable.

Any cabling across adjacent panels shall be laid in the form of patch cord.

Cable Management and Accessories shall include bend radius and physical
protec on to ensure cables are properly handled, supported, and protected to
prevent any micro or macro bending or subjected to any poten al tensile load.

Cable Management shall also ensure proper design of cable rou ng paths and
easy cable access.

Green enclosed metal trunking, racks, cleats and supports are to be supplied
under this item.

Type of cable between IED to Communica on Panel shall be referred to the


product technical specifica on.

DC ONE (1) SET OF 110V NICKEL CADMIUM BATTERIES, DC CHARGERS AND
DISTRIBUTION SWITCHBOARDS (2x100% ba ery capacity, 2 x 100% charger) to
be installed in the substa on switch house in accordance with the requirements
of this Specifica on, comprising: -

a) Two banks of nickel cadmium ba eries shall be equal or more than 250Ah
each at the rated 5-hour rate of discharge (type C5) to meet the total
requirements of standing load (8 hours discharge period) and transient load
together with ba ery rack.
b) Two DC chargers with minimum float charge ra ng of 50A per charger and
fi ed with float and boost charge facili es suitable for the specified ba ery
capacity and standing load of all equipment, interlocking facili es, charger
control and alarm monitoring facili es.
c) Two double pole contactors or isolators for outgoing supplies from charger
to distribu on boards
d) Two sets main ba ery wall mounted switch fuse from chargers to ba ery
banks
e) Low Electrolyte Level Probe (LELP) detector with insulator at both ends to be
supplied and installed by Ba ery Manufacturer/ Ba ery Supplier
f) DC distribu on boards complete with instruments, lamps and switches with
segregated busbars, double pole MCBs/MCCBs minimum (20 nos – 16A, 35
nos – 32A, 5 nos – 63A) for all outgoing DC supply to all equipment of each
bay.
g) Definite spare including spare control and alarm cards, and maintenance
accessories as listed in the technical specifica ons.
h) All the necessary contactors, switches, sliding link terminal blocks, DC earth
fault relays, DC transducers, Ammeters, Voltmeters, wiring, blocking diode,
termina on, labels, heaters, etc. to complete.
i) Set of equipment earthing system including copper tape, copper bar,
electrodes, test links, connec ons from substa on earthing to equipment,
etc. to complete associated with this schedule.
j) DC ba ery sizing, DC charger sizing and DC loading calcula on for all
equipment including 20% spare load shall be submi ed for approval.

CABLE INSTALLATION WORKS

The cables shall be laid in a combina on of the following erec on methods: -


a) Cable trench.

Page 26 of 34
b) Buried direct in ground with pipe on concrete pla orm on pile (subject to soil
inves ga on result).
c) Concrete encased pipes under substa on road.
d) Cable cellar with trays, ladders, and supports.
e) Cable cellar on the floor with supports.
f) Cable sha with trays, ladders, and supports.

The installa on described in the erec on methods above shall include: -


a) u lity mapping and trial holes,
b) supply of all material and workmanship as per TNB requirement,
c) excava on, trenching, hacking, and coring,
d) encased with grade 20 concrete under substa on road,
e) cable trench crossing and other cable crossings, where applicable.
f) complete fill with si ed sand in cable trench,
g) sand for direct buried,
h) concrete cable protec ve slabs,
i) reinstatement of exis ng surfaces,
j) cable route marking,
k) labelling for all types of cables laid at both ends,
l) cable ladders/trays,
m) cable clamps and supports,
n) cable cleats,
o) steel works,
p) applica on of fire-retardant paint for all exposed power cables,
q) fire block mortar at cable entrance, etc., to complete as per contract
specifica on.

All join ng and termina on works shall be carried out by Cer fied Cable Jointers
approved by TNB. The jointers shall have valid competency cer ficates issued by
the joint and termina on manufacturer for the relevant voltage level and
par cular model offered for installa on.
